| Industy | Sub-industry | Part name | Material | Process | Technical advantages |
| Railway transportation | Railway parts | wear plate | Mn13 | Coated sand casting | The coated sand casting uses independent sand preparation, with stable quality, good product surface finish and high production efficiency. |
| Railway parts | stop block | Ductile Iron QT700-2 | Coated sand casting | The coated sand casting uses independent sand preparation, with stable quality, good product surface finish and high production efficiency. |
| Carriage parts | carriage lock hook | Carbon steel | Lost wax casting | Lost wax casting process, using silica sol in the pre-process, good product surface quality, less mold cost, and small quatity production. |

1.Outstanding Mechanical Properties:
In the world of railway transportation vehicles, every component must endure a spectrum of complex loads, encompassing traction, braking, and vibrations. Through meticulous material selection and sophisticated casting processes, cast parts boast remarkable high strength, toughness, and wear resistance. Take, for instance, the couplers crafted from high-strength alloy steel; they masterfully withstand immense pulling and impact forces during vehicular connections and operations, thus ensuring the train's safe and seamless functionality.
2.Adaptability to Intricate Forms:
In railway transportation the structural complexity of components, such as the artistry found in bogie frames and gearboxes, defy conventional manufacturing methods. The casting process shines by producing parts of intricate and complex shapes as dictated by design requisites, catering to the unique structural and functional demands of railway transportation. For instance, casting facilitates the precise formation of internal reinforcing ribs, cavities, and other sophisticated structures within bogie frames, achieving weight reduction without compromising strength and integrity.

Materials We Cast
| Material | Carbon Steel | Ductile Iron | Alloy Steel | Stainless Steel | Manganese Steel |
| Material Grade/Designation | ZG200-400 ZG230-450 ZG270-500 ZG310-570 ZG340-640 Q235 | QT350-22L QT400-18 QT400-18L QT450-10 QT500-7 QT600-3 QT700-2 QT800-2 QT900-2 QTD800-10 QTD900-8 QTD1050-6 QTD1200-3 QTD1400-1 | ZG20Mn, ZG30Mn ZG40Mn, ZG20Mn2 ZG35CrMnSi, ZG40Cr ZG35CrMo, ZG42CrMo AH36,EH36,FH36 Q420qE,Q500qE 16MnDR 09MnNiDR ZGD410-620 ZGD535-720 ZGD650-830 ZGD730-310 ZGD840-1030 ZGD1030-1240 ZGD1240-1450 | 06Cr19Ni10 022Cr19Ni10 06Cr17Ni12Mo2 022Cr17Ni12Mo2 06Cr18Ni12Mo2Cu2 015Cr21Ni26Mo5Cu2 12Cr13 30Cr13 68Cr17 022Cr12 10Cr17 019Cr19Mo2NbTi 022Cr23Ni5Mo3N 022Cr25Ni7Mo4N 05Cr17Ni4Cu4Nb 07Cr15Ni7Mo2AL | ZGMn13-1 ZGMn13-2 ZGMn13-3 ZGMn13Cr2 Q355B Q460C 30Mn2Cr10 40Mn18Cr3 ZGMn18Cr2 |
| Standard | AISI - American Iron and Steel Institute ASTM - American Society for Testing and Materials DIN - Deutsches Institut für Normung BS - British Standards ANSI - American National Standards Institute JIS - Japanese Industrial Standards AFNOR - Association Française de Normalisation AS - Standards Australia ASME - American Society of Mechanical Engineers EN--European Norm GB--National Standard Chinese |
| Note | Apart from the above materials, we can cast based on customers' specifications |

Wooden Box Packaging:
Our wooden box packaging solution is meticulously designed for cast steel parts of all dimensions, particularly those of larger scale. Offering superior compressive strength and protective features, these boxes prevent any potential squeezing or collision during transit. Our process involves initial wrapping with plastic film or oil paper, followed by secure placement in the box, supported by wooden wedges or foam materials to ensure steadfast stability.
Carton Packaging:
For smaller cast steel components, our carton packaging provides a lightweight and budget-friendly option. While ensuring adequate strength and moisture resistance, our method involves wrapping parts in plastic or bubble bags, followed by a snug fit within the carton. Fillers are strategically used to eliminate any movement inside, maintaining the integrity of your parts.
Pallet Packaging:
In the realm of mass production, pallet packaging emerges as a preferred choice for cast steel parts. These parts are meticulously arranged on pallets and secured with stretch film or strapping tape, facilitating easy handling and transportation via forklifts. Ideal for uniform specifications common in the agricultural and construction machinery sectors, this method ensures efficiency and protection.
